¿Qué problemas resuelve EDB Postgres AI for CloudNativePG ¿Y cómo te beneficia eso?
1) Problema: Ejecutar PostgreSQL en Kubernetes es difícil
PostgreSQL tradicional no fue diseñado para Kubernetes. Desplegar, escalar, hacer copias de seguridad y asegurar alta disponibilidad en un entorno nativo de la nube a menudo requiere muchas herramientas personalizadas y esfuerzo manual.
Cómo lo soluciona Cloud native pg
Utiliza operadores de Kubernetes y CRDs para representar clústeres de PostgreSQL como objetos nativos de Kubernetes.
Automatiza el aprovisionamiento, conmutación por error/recuperación, copias de seguridad y restauraciones, y actualizaciones y escalado.
Beneficio
Obtienes PostgreSQL nativo de la nube con autocuración sin tener que reinventar las herramientas operativas. Los equipos de DevOps/Plataforma pasan menos tiempo en la infraestructura de la base de datos y más tiempo entregando características.
2) Problema: PostgreSQL empresarial necesita más que OSS
PostgreSQL estándar es poderoso, pero las grandes organizaciones a menudo necesitan seguridad mejorada, herramientas avanzadas de rendimiento, soporte empresarial y características de cumplimiento.
Cómo EDB mejora PostgreSQL
La distribución de EDB se basa en PostgreSQL con herramientas de monitoreo y ajuste de rendimiento, endurecimiento adicional de seguridad, características de recuperación ante desastres y opciones de soporte profesional empresarial.
Beneficio
Las organizaciones obtienen capacidades operativas y de soporte de nivel empresarial que reducen el riesgo en producción. Los equipos se sienten más seguros al ejecutar sistemas con SLA.
3) Problema: Las copias de seguridad, conmutación por error y flujos de trabajo de DR son dolorosos
En un mundo nativo de la nube, las cosas fallan: los pods se bloquean, el almacenamiento se comporta mal y los nodos se caen. Los enfoques tradicionales a menudo dependen de scripts personalizados o herramientas externas.
Cómo ayuda EDB Postgres AI
Automatiza las copias de seguridad, la recuperación a un punto en el tiempo y la replicación. Se integra con los primitivos de almacenamiento y orquestación de Kubernetes, y maneja los procesos de conmutación por error y elección de manera más fluida.
Beneficio
Obtienes mayor resiliencia con menos intervención manual durante las interrupciones, además de una recuperación más rápida con un comportamiento más predecible.
4) Problema: Sobrecarga operativa para los equipos de Dev y Ops
Sin una solución unificada, los equipos terminan manejando múltiples herramientas: programadores separados, pilas de monitoreo, scripts personalizados para copias de seguridad y planes de escalado manuales.
Cómo ayuda esta pila
Todo se gestiona a través de las API de Kubernetes y se integra con las herramientas nativas de la nube existentes (métricas, registros, GitOps). Esto reduce el cambio de contexto y mantiene las operaciones más consistentes.
Beneficio
Los equipos ganan consistencia y previsibilidad, especialmente en configuraciones de múltiples clústeres o múltiples entornos. El soporte para patrones de GitOps también mejora la auditabilidad y la reproducibilidad.
5) Problema: Las cargas de trabajo emergentes (IA, análisis) quieren más
Las aplicaciones modernas, especialmente aquellas que involucran análisis de datos, IA/ML y conocimientos en tiempo real, imponen nuevas demandas a las bases de datos.
Cómo encaja "Postgres AI"
Permite flujos de trabajo amigables con IA/ML, soporta extensiones emergentes y patrones de datos tipo vector, y posiciona a Postgres como una plataforma de datos más multipropósito.
Beneficio
Puedes construir aplicaciones ricas en datos sin cambiar a almacenes completamente nuevos. También puede simplificar la arquitectura al usar PostgreSQL como una única fuente para datos relacionales y analíticos.
Resumen de beneficios generales
Operaciones difíciles de Postgres en Kubernetes: menos trabajo manual, más automatización.
Falta de características empresariales: una base de datos más segura, con mejor rendimiento y soporte.
Copias de seguridad y DR complejas: mejor resiliencia y recuperación más rápida.
Herramientas operativas disjuntas: flujos de trabajo más unificados y compatibilidad con GitOps.
Demandas de aplicaciones modernas: una base de plataforma de datos más preparada para el futuro.
Cómo te beneficia esto (o a tu equipo)
Hay menos "apagafuegos" porque muchas tareas rutinarias están automatizadas. La fiabilidad mejora porque puedes confiar más en la base de datos en producción. La entrega es más rápida porque los desarrolladores pasan más tiempo en características y menos en operaciones. La escalabilidad es más fluida a medida que las aplicaciones crecen, y los equipos se alinean mejor porque Dev, Ops y SRE pueden compartir los mismos flujos de trabajo. Reseña recopilada por y alojada en G2.com.